Products made from vegetables, fruit, nuts and other plant parts
This group covers goods made from vegetables, fruit, nuts and other plant parts. The specific category depends on how the plant material has been prepared or preserved, such as with vinegar, by freezing, with sugar, by cooking or as juice.
For example
- Pickled cucumbers
- Tomato sauce
- Frozen peas
- Apple juice

Duty rates shown here are estimates, read from official EU / Danish, Norwegian and UK tariff data for orientation only. Confirm the current rate with SKAT, TARIC, Norwegian Customs or the UK Online Trade Tariff before you file. The rate you pay can also depend on the country of origin. These are base customs duties only: import VAT, excise duties, anti-dumping duties and safeguard or quota measures are not included.
